About

Masoomeh Khalifeh is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Epidemiology and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Masoomeh Khalifeh has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 344 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 4 papers in Epidemiology and 3 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in Masoomeh Khalifeh’s work include R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(3 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(2 papers) and Digestive system and related health (2 papers). Masoomeh Khalifeh is often cited by papers focused on R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(3 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(2 papers) and Digestive system and related health (2 papers). Masoomeh Khalifeh collaborates with scholars based in Iran, Bahrain and Ireland. Masoomeh Khalifeh's co-authors include Amirhossein Sahebkar, George E. Barreto, Morgayn I. Read, Anahita Sanaei Dashti, Maciej Banach, Peter E. Penson, Ahmad Movahedpour, Mortaza Taheri‐Anganeh, Abdollah Karimi and Zahra Shabaninejad and has published in prestigious journals such as 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ces, British Journal of Pharmacology and International Journal of Pharmaceutics.
